This web page is using cookies

Your location is United States.

Sapa City of Industry, CA

Sapa's Extrusion plant in City of Industry, California, USA provides extrusion, machining, and fabrication services.

Sapa City of Industry, CA 18111 E. Railroad St, 91748 CA City of Industry
+1 800-210-5393 Contact location

Image aluminium-2016-11.jpg

Extrusion Presses

2350 ton - 8"
2650 ton - 10"
3000 ton - 11"